Set out on a captivating half-day journey from Skopje, North Macedonia, blending history, culture, and nature. Begin your adventure atop Vodno Mountain, where the towering Millennium Cross offers sweeping views of the city and a powerful symbol of Macedonia’s Christian heritage.
Continue to the Church of Saint Panteleimon in Gorno Nerezi, renowned for its exquisite medieval frescoes. Take a moment to appreciate the artistry and tranquility of this historic site, which draws visitors eager to experience its spiritual and cultural significance.
Next, immerse yourself in the natural beauty of Matka Canyon, a beloved outdoor escape just west of Skopje. Explore the canyon’s dramatic landscapes, visit the ancient St. Andrew’s Monastery, and discover the oldest artificial lake in North Macedonia, all while enjoying free time for photos and exploration.
